hamsterbase 最近的时间轴更新
hamsterbase

hamsterbase

V2EX 第 579049 号会员,加入于 2022-04-23 00:05:50 +08:00
今日活跃度排名 8243
我在 apple store 上架了一个 nodejs 的应用
程序员  •  hamsterbase  •  67 天前  •  最后回复来自 pao8pin5
1
独立开发者最适合的办公地点--寺庙了解一下
  •  1   
    程序员  •  hamsterbase  •  96 天前  •  最后回复来自 ttvast
    54
    用 vitepress 重写了官网,求大家点评一下。
    分享创造  •  hamsterbase  •  146 天前  •  最后回复来自 Jynxio
    6
    hamsterbase 最近回复了
    16 小时 46 分钟前
    回复了 Jaeger 创建的主题 软件 有 Cubox 的替代品推荐吗? Cubox 文章解析实在是太糟糕
    @Jaeger

    这个月吧,这几天我会先发布一个 TestFlight 。
    17 小时 14 分钟前
    回复了 Jaeger 创建的主题 软件 有 Cubox 的替代品推荐吗? Cubox 文章解析实在是太糟糕
    可以试试看我开发的 hamsterbase 。

    基于快照开发,几乎任何网站都可以解析。
    建议看看 CRDT ,这个是本地优先软件的未来。
    1 天前
    回复了 James369 创建的主题 程序员 现在前端对比较实时的场景能否胜任?
    https://ys.mihoyo.com/cloud/#/

    可以试试看网页里玩原神。 有 60 帧
    3 天前
    回复了 bigoxEvan 创建的主题 奇思妙想 想做一个软件:万物离线阅读
    1. 可以试试看 singilefile 插件,可以设定网页加载好以后就自动保存,保存位置可以选 本地磁盘,webdav 网盘。

    2. 如果想进一步回顾、整理。 可以试试看我开发的 hamsterbase , 本地离线阅读、批注、全文搜索。

    还提供了 API 文档,可以调用接口保存 https://hamsterbase.com/developer/api/webpages.html#upload-webpage

    hamsterbase 也提供了 webdav 模拟的功能,支持绑定 singilefile.
    @nullico


    react native 内置 nodejs 使用的是这个项目。


    https://github.com/nodejs-mobile/nodejs-mobile-react-native


    可以运行 nodejs 与 native module 。

    如果是 native module , 需要自己重新构建一下。 一般需要构建 3 份,分别为 iOS 模拟器,iOS 真机,安卓。

    具体可以看 https://github.com/nodejs-mobile/prebuild-for-nodejs-mobile
    是没什么毛病, 我的软件就是这么架构的。


    1. pc 是 electron 套 nodejs
    2. docker 版是容器里启动 nodejs
    3. iOS ,安卓,iPad 版是 react native 里套 nodejs



    这样一份代码实现了几乎所有平台。 在网页版里,前后端通过 websocket 通信。 在 electron 里通过 electron ipc 通信。
    6 天前
    回复了 Jaeger 创建的主题 软件 Obsidian 最优的跨平台数据同步方案是什么?
    我用 logseq 同步 obsidian , 然后再用 git 同步 logseq 。


    目前的目录结构是这样的

    .
    ├── .git
    ├── logseq-sync
    └── ── obsidian


    1. 首先在一台电脑上设置 git , 使用 git 备份所有的数据。 这样可以让知识库拥有完整的编辑历史,防止误删除

    2. 然后建立一个 logseq-sync 的文件夹,使用 logseq 官方的同步。 任何想要同步的设备,仅需登录 logseq 账户即可,无需 git 。logseq 会同步 logseq-sync 文件夹下的所有文件夹

    3. 在 logseq-sync 文件夹下新建一个 obsidian 文件夹,存放 obsidian 的数据。

    4. 在 logseq 的 config.edn 里配置 :hidden ["/obsidian"] , 这样可以防止 obsidian 的数据污染 logseq


    说一下我这样的缺点

    1. 不支持 iOS
    这种黑产很多的。 我有一个域名就是忘记续费后,直接被抢注搞菠菜了。
    我自荐 hamsterbase


    1. 目前免费内测中。 未来发布,现在的版本也不需要付费。

    2. 提供 iOS ,安卓,docker ,linux ,windows ,macos ,docker 版,还有 chrome 插件。

    所有客户端都支持独立、离线使用。

    3. 所有平台支持点对点同步, 也支持 iCloud 等同步。 未来支持 webdav

    4. 数据都在本地,不需要服务器,不收集任何信息,不需要注册账户。

    5. 支持全文搜索、批注、标签。



    目前安卓版只适配了平板, 适配手机的版本开发中,预计下个月发布。
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   我们的愿景   ·   实用小工具   ·   1083 人在线   最高记录 6543   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 20ms · UTC 22:57 · PVG 06:57 · LAX 14:57 · JFK 17:57
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.